How a Real Estate Agent Helps Buyers Find the Good Property

Finding the right property generally is a challenging process. With 1000’s of listings, fluctuating market conditions, and complicated legal requirements, many buyers quickly realize that buying a home is more sophisticated than it first appears. A real estate agent plays an important role in guiding buyers through each stage of the process, serving to them determine the appropriate property while avoiding costly mistakes.

A real estate agent begins by understanding the buyer’s needs, preferences, and financial situation. This step is essential because each purchaser has completely different goals. Some buyers are looking for a family home in a quiet neighborhood, while others could want a modern apartment in a busy city center. By discussing factors resembling budget, preferred location, property size, and desired features, the agent can slim down the options and focus only on properties that match the customer’s criteria.

One of the valuable benefits of working with a real estate agent is access to a wide range of property listings. While buyers can search on-line, many listings aren’t widely advertised or may be newly available on the market. Real estate agents have access to professional databases and industry networks that provide information about properties earlier than they develop into seen to the general public. This early access will increase the chances of finding high quality properties before competition becomes intense.

Market knowledge is another key advantage provided by a real estate agent. Property values differ significantly depending on location, demand, local development, and financial trends. A professional agent understands how these factors affect pricing and might help buyers determine whether a property is fairly valued. Without this experience, buyers could risk overpaying for a property or lacking a good investment opportunity.

Real estate agents also help buyers consider properties more effectively. Throughout property visits, an skilled agent can point out important details that buyers may overlook. Structural condition, renovation potential, neighborhood characteristics, and future development plans can all affect the long term value of a property. By providing trustworthy assessments, the agent helps buyers make informed decisions slightly than emotional ones.

Negotiation is one other area where a real estate agent adds significant value. As soon as a buyer finds a suitable property, the following step is making an offer. Negotiating the acquisition value, contract terms, and conditions might be troublesome without experience. Real estate agents signify the buyer’s interests and work to secure the best possible deal. They understand common negotiation strategies and know methods to communicate successfully with sellers and their representatives.

The paperwork concerned in purchasing a property can also be complex. Real estate transactions usually require a number of documents, legal disclosures, and monetary agreements. A real estate agent helps make sure that all documents are completed accurately and submitted on time. This reduces the risk of delays, misunderstandings, or legal problems that might jeopardize the transaction.

One other essential role of a real estate agent is coordinating with different professionals concerned in the buying process. Mortgage brokers, home inspectors, lawyers, and appraisers all contribute to a profitable purchase. The agent acts as a central point of communication, making certain that each step is completed smoothly and according to schedule. This coordination simplifies the process for buyers and reduces stress during what can otherwise be a sophisticated experience.

In addition to practical assist, real estate agents additionally provide reassurance and steerage throughout the complete journey. Buying a property is without doubt one of the largest financial decisions most individuals will ever make. Having a knowledgeable professional available to answer questions and provide advice can make the process far more comfortable and efficient.

A skilled real estate agent combines market expertise, negotiation skills, and professional networks to assist buyers find the precise property with confidence. By understanding the customer’s goals and guiding them through every stage of the transaction, the agent transforms a fancy process into a structured and manageable experience. For a lot of buyers, working with a real estate agent is the key to successfully discovering the right property.
